Post rear speakers

Does anyone have experience with what type of rear deck speakers would best fit a 86 930 ? I see lots of types but not sure which would give me the best performance and fit.

I've replaced my old rear speakers with the new Blau's. I believe the number is PC4X6 or something like that. My old grills were sun cracked and these came with black grills.

What you need to do is find speakers with very little depth (1-5/8") because others won't fit into the oval cut into the metal under the decking. If they are too deep, they will either touch the metal and vibrate or they will stick up above the deck so no grill will work.

I've hear the MB Quarts and they sound awesome, but I don't think they fit w/o some cutting.

no matter what you install, if your 930 is to stay relatively 'stock', no sound system will be really good due to the size and number of speakers constraint.

Your stock rear deck requires metric 4x6 speakers with around a 1.75" top mount depth.
I reccommend buying a new rear deck that will give you about 3 inches of mounting depth and the choice to install whatever you want. Some come pre cut for 6x9's. These cars don't really have any good options to install a sub so I reccomend going with a very good 6x9 that will not only handle a decent amount of power but also has the capabilities of produceing some low frequencies(base). MB quart, ads, Boston Acoustics, Alpine just to name a few. You will be very surprised at how well a couple of 5.25 coaxals up front and a pair of 6x9's coaxls(2 way) in the rear and a nice 50x4(at 4 ohms) amp will sound. Your not going to get any earth shattering lowes but you will get a crisp punchy mid/low that you can listen to at very high levels without any distortion. Performance offers the new rear deck and you can also find a couple of dealers in the back of an Excellence mag. Hope this helps. Eric
